.industry-section{display:block;padding:0 0 140px;position:relative}.top-impact-companies-search .filter-caption{align-items:center;display:flex;justify-content:space-between;margin:0 0 80px!important;width:100%}.top-impact-companies-search .filter-caption p{border-bottom:1px solid #eb2d2e;color:#eb2d2e;font-family:Abolition Test,sans-serif;font-size:34px;line-height:100%;margin:0;padding:0 0 10px}.industry-section .search-caption{align-items:center;display:flex;gap:20px;width:auto}.industry-section .search-caption .form-item{position:relative;width:auto}.industry-section .search-caption .form-item input{-webkit-appearance:none;-moz-appearance:none;appearance:none;background:transparent;border:1px solid #eb2d2e;border-radius:10px;box-shadow:none!important;color:#fff;font-family:Outfit,sans-serif;font-size:16px;line-height:24px;outline:0!important;padding:12px 20px}.industry-section .search-caption .form-item input::-moz-placeholder{color:hsla(0,0%,100%,.6)}.industry-section .search-caption .form-item input::placeholder{color:hsla(0,0%,100%,.6)}input[type=search]::-webkit-search-cancel-button,input[type=search]::-webkit-search-decoration,input[type=search]::-webkit-search-results-button,input[type=search]::-webkit-search-results-decoration{display:none}.industry-section .search-caption .search-input svg{position:absolute;right:20px;top:50%;transform:translateY(-50%)}.industry-section .filter-btn{align-items:center;background:#eb2d2e;background-color:#eb2d2e!important;border:0;box-shadow:none;display:flex;font-family:Outfit,sans-serif;font-size:16px;gap:10px;line-height:24px;outline:0!important;padding:13px 30px;text-transform:none}.industry-section .filter-btn:hover{color:#fff}.industry-cards-info{flex-direction:column;gap:30px;margin:0 0 100px}.industry-card,.industry-cards-info{display:flex;position:relative;width:100%}.industry-card{align-items:center;background:hsla(0,0%,100%,.039);border:4px solid transparent;border-radius:20px;cursor:pointer;justify-content:space-between;padding:26px 30px;transition:all .3s ease-in-out}.industry-card:before{border-left:4px solid #eb2d2e;border-radius:20px;content:"";height:calc(100% + 8px);left:-4px;position:absolute;top:-4px;width:calc(100% + 8px);z-index:-1}.idtry_heading{gap:80px;width:auto}.idtry-number,.idtry_heading{align-items:center;display:flex}.idtry-number{background:rgba(235,45,46,.102);border-radius:120px;color:#eb2d2e;font-family:Oswald;font-size:130px;height:160px;justify-content:center;line-height:100%;min-width:160px;width:160px}.card-tagline{color:#eb2d2e;display:block;font-size:14px;line-height:24px;margin:0 0 5px;text-transform:uppercase}.idtry_heading h2{align-items:self-end;color:#fff;display:flex;font-size:60px;gap:5px;line-height:100%;margin:0 0 30px}.idtry_heading h2 img{display:inline-flex;-o-object-fit:cover;object-fit:cover;width:auto}.idtry_heading p{color:hsla(0,0%,100%,.702);font-size:16px;line-height:24px;margin:0}.card-social-item{align-items:center;display:flex;gap:30px}.card-social-item .social-icons{align-items:center;display:flex;gap:10px;opacity:0;transition:all .3s ease-in-out}.card-social-item .social-icons a{align-items:center;background:rgba(235,45,46,.102);border-radius:100px;display:flex;justify-content:center;min-width:40px;padding:10px}.card-social-item .social-icons a img{max-height:20px;max-width:20px;width:100%}.industry-card .card-btn{align-items:center;background:transparent;border:3px solid #fff;border-radius:140px;display:flex;height:100px;justify-content:center;min-width:100px;transition:all .3s ease-in-out;width:100px}.industry-card .card-btn img{display:block;width:auto}.industry-card:hover{border-color:#eb2d2e}.industry-card:hover .card-btn{background:#fff}.industry-card:hover .card-social-item .social-icons{opacity:1}.idtry-number{font-family:Roads}.card-row-wrapper{display:flex;flex-wrap:wrap;gap:30px;margin-top:70px}.card-half-caption{width:calc(50% - 15px)}.industry-card.sm-card{align-items:flex-start}.industry-card.sm-card .idtry-number{background:hsla(0,0%,100%,.039);color:#fff;font-size:100px;height:130px;min-width:130px;width:130px}.industry-card.sm-card .idtry_heading{gap:20px}.industry-card.sm-card .card-tagline{font-size:12px}.industry-card.sm-card .idtry_heading h2{font-size:32px;margin:0 0 20px}.industry-card.sm-card .idtry_heading p{font-size:16px}.industry-card.sm-card .card-btn{border-width:2px;height:50px;min-width:50px;width:50px}.industry-card.sm-card .card-btn img{max-width:14px}.industry-card.sm-card .card-social-item .social-icons a{min-width:30px;padding:8px}.industry-card.sm-card .card-social-item{gap:10px}.card-excerpt-text{color:hsla(0,0%,100%,.702);font-size:20px!important;line-height:24px}.industry-cards-info .no-results{color:#fff}.industry-filter{position:relative}.industry-dropdown{background:#0a0a0a;border-radius:10px;display:none;left:0;max-height:350px;overflow-x:hidden;overflow-y:auto;position:absolute;top:100%;width:100%;z-index:10}.industry-filter.open .industry-dropdown{display:block}.industry-dropdown li{color:hsla(0,0%,100%,.702);cursor:pointer;padding:10px}.industry-dropdown li:hover{background:hsla(0,0%,100%,.1)}ul.industry-dropdown::-webkit-scrollbar-track{background-color:#1c1c1c}ul.industry-dropdown::-webkit-scrollbar{background-color:#1c1c1c;width:6px}ul.industry-dropdown::-webkit-scrollbar-thumb{background-color:#7c7c7c}.pagination-wrapper{align-items:center;display:flex;gap:10px;justify-content:center}.pagination-wrapper .arrow{cursor:pointer;max-width:14px;width:100%}.pagination-wrapper .arrow.disable{opacity:.5;pointer-events:none}.pagination-wrapper .pagination-number{display:flex;flex-wrap:wrap;gap:10px;justify-content:center}.pagination-wrapper .pagination-number a{align-items:center;border:1px solid hsla(0,0%,100%,.4);border-radius:100px;color:hsla(0,0%,100%,.4);display:flex;font-size:16px;height:30px;justify-content:center;line-height:100%;min-width:30px}.pagination-wrapper .pagination-number a.active{background:#eb2d2e;border-color:#eb2d2e;color:#fff}@media only screen and (max-width:1199px){.industry-cards-info{margin:0 0 80px}.industry-section .filter-caption{margin:0 0 70px}.industry-card{padding:20px 24px}.idtry_heading{gap:40px}.idtry-number{font-size:90px;height:120px;min-width:120px;width:120px}.card-social-item{gap:10px}.industry-card .card-btn{height:70px;min-width:70px;padding:22px;width:70px}.idtry_heading h2{font-size:38px;margin:0 0 20px}.idtry_heading p{font-size:16px}.card-row-wrapper{gap:20px;margin-top:50px}.card-half-caption{width:calc(50% - 10px)}.industry-card.sm-card .idtry-number{font-size:60px;height:84px;min-width:84px;width:84px}.industry-card.sm-card{padding:16px 20px}.industry-card.sm-card .card-social-item .social-icons a{min-width:26px;padding:7px}.card-social-item .social-icons{gap:8px}.industry-card.sm-card .card-btn{border-width:2px;height:38px;min-width:38px;padding:0;width:38px}.industry-card.sm-card .card-tagline{line-height:16px}.industry-card.sm-card .idtry_heading p{font-size:14px;line-height:20px}}@media only screen and (max-width:991px){.card-half-caption{width:100%}.industry-section{padding:0 0 100px}}@media only screen and (max-width:767px){.industry-section{margin:0 0 80px}.industry-cards-info{padding:0 0 60px}.industry-section .filter-caption{flex-wrap:wrap;gap:20px;margin:0 0 60px}.industry-section .search-caption{flex-wrap:wrap;width:100%}.industry-section .filter-btn,.industry-section .search-caption .form-item input{justify-content:center;width:100%}.industry-section .search-caption .form-item{width:100%}.idtry-number{font-size:60px;height:84px;min-width:84px;width:84px}.industry-card{padding:16px 20px}.industry-card .card-social-item .social-icons a{min-width:26px;padding:7px}.card-social-item .social-icons{gap:8px}.industry-card .card-btn{border-width:2px;height:38px;min-width:38px;padding:0;width:38px}.industry-card .card-tagline{line-height:16px}.industry-card .idtry_heading p{font-size:14px;line-height:20px}.industry-card .idtry_heading h2{font-size:32px;margin:0 0 20px}.idtry_heading{gap:20px}.industry-card .card-tagline{font-size:12px}.industry-card .card-btn img{max-width:14px}.card-row-wrapper{margin-top:0}}@media only screen and (max-width:579px){.industry-card{flex-wrap:wrap;gap:24px}.industry-card,.industry-card:before{border-radius:12px}.idtry_heading{flex-wrap:wrap;width:100%}.card-social-item{justify-content:flex-end;width:100%}.card-social-item .social-icons{opacity:1}.industry-cards-info{gap:20px}.idtry-info{width:calc(100% - 104px)}.card-social-item .social-icons a img{max-width:16px}}.pagination-wrapper a.page-numbers:not(.prev):not(.next),.pagination-wrapper span.page-numbers.current{align-items:center;border:1px solid hsla(0,0%,100%,.2);border-radius:100px;display:flex;height:36px;justify-content:center;min-width:36px}.pagination-wrapper span.page-numbers.current{background:#eb2d2e;border-color:#eb2d2e;color:#fff}.pagination-wrapper a.page-numbers.next,.pagination-wrapper a.page-numbers.prev{border:none!important;color:#eb2d2e;height:auto;min-width:auto;padding:0 10px}.pagination-wrapper a.page-numbers.next:hover,.pagination-wrapper a.page-numbers.prev:hover{background:none;color:#eb2d2e}.verified-real-leaders-award-page .modal_open{overflow:hidden}.popup_wrapper{align-items:center;backdrop-filter:blur(20px);background:linear-gradient(rgba(50,50,50,.48),rgba(50,50,50,.48));display:flex;flex-flow:column;height:100%;inset:0 auto auto 0;justify-content:flex-start;opacity:0;overflow:auto;position:fixed;transition-duration:.55s;transition-property:all;transition-timing-function:ease-in-out;width:100%;z-index:-1}.popup_wrapper.open_popup{opacity:1;z-index:11000}.backdrop_overlay{display:flex;flex-flow:column;max-width:1300px;padding:62px .625rem .625rem;pointer-events:auto;transform:translateY(100%);width:100%}.backdrop_overlay.active_overlay{transform:translate(0);transition:transform .65s}.modal-close-button-wrapper{align-items:flex-start;display:inline-flex;height:0;justify-content:flex-end;position:sticky;top:1rem;width:auto;z-index:999999}.modal-close-button{align-items:center;cursor:pointer;display:flex;height:36px;justify-content:center;margin-right:1rem;margin-top:1.875rem;position:sticky;top:16rem;width:36px;z-index:9999999}.close_icon{width:100%}.modal_content_wrapper{background-color:hsla(0,0%,7%,.831);border-left:4px solid #cf3232;border-radius:20px;position:relative;visibility:visible;z-index:110001}.content_area{display:inline-block;margin:40px auto 40px 0;max-width:calc(100% - 60px);padding-left:40px;width:100%}.content-inner{align-items:flex-start;display:flex;gap:80px;position:relative;width:100%}.content-inner .popup-number{width:160px}.content-inner .popup-number .idtry-number{margin:0 auto 40px}.content-inner .popup-number .card-social-item{justify-content:center}.content-inner .card-social-item .social-icons{opacity:1}.content-inner .popup-content-area{max-width:712px;width:calc(100% - 240px)}.content-inner h2 .card-social-item{margin-left:15px}.content-inner h2 .card-social-item .social-icons a{padding:10px 16px}.content-inner h2 .card-social-item .social-icons a img{max-width:18px}.content-inner .popup-content-area p{margin:0 0 30px}.card-info-text{font-size:16px!important;margin:0!important}.content-inner .popup-content-area .popup-list-info{-moz-column-gap:30px;column-gap:30px;display:flex;flex-wrap:wrap;margin:0 0 30px;row-gap:20px}.content-inner .popup-content-area .popup-list-info li{align-items:center;display:inline-flex;gap:10px;width:auto}.content-inner .popup-content-area .popup-list-info li span{max-width:15px;width:100%}.content-inner .popup-content-area .popup-list-info li span img{display:block;-o-object-fit:cover;object-fit:cover;width:100%}.content-inner .popup-content-area .popup-list-info li p{color:#fff;font-size:16px;margin:0;white-space:nowrap}.content-inner .popup-content-area .popup-list-info li mark{color:hsla(0,0%,100%,.702)}@media only screen and (max-width:1024px){.content-inner{gap:40px}}@media only screen and (max-width:767px){.content-inner .popup-number{min-width:84px;width:84px}.content-inner{gap:24px}.content-inner .popup-content-area{width:calc(100% - 108px)}.content-inner .popup-content-area .popup-list-info,.content-inner .popup-content-area p{margin:0 0 16px}.content-inner .card-social-item .social-icons a,.content-inner h2 .card-social-item .social-icons a{min-width:26px;padding:7px}.content-inner .card-social-item .social-icons a img,.content-inner h2 .card-social-item .social-icons a img{max-width:14px}.content-inner h2{flex-wrap:wrap}.content-inner h2 .card-social-item .social-icons a{padding:7px 12px}.content-inner .popup-number .idtry-number{margin:0 auto 20px}.modal_content_wrapper{border-radius:12px}.content-inner .popup-content-area .idtry-info{width:100%!important}.content-inner h2 .card-social-item{justify-content:flex-start!important;margin-left:5px;width:auto}.content_area{margin:30px auto 30px 0;max-width:calc(100% - 50px);padding-left:24px}.modal-close-button{height:30px;margin-right:10px;margin-top:30px;width:30px}.card-info-text,.content-inner .popup-content-area .popup-list-info li p{font-size:14px!important;line-height:22px!important}.content-inner .popup-content-area .popup-list-info{row-gap:16px}}@media only screen and (max-width:479px){.content-inner{flex-wrap:wrap}.content-inner .popup-content-area,.content-inner .popup-number{width:100%}.content-inner .popup-number .idtry-number{margin:0 0 20px}.content-inner .popup-number .card-social-item{justify-content:flex-start}}
